Buying Guide

Key factors to consider when choosing a gold skeleton pocket watch include movement type, case design, readability, chain length, and maintenance needs. The following questions help guide a practical selection.

What movement should I choose?

Mechanical hand-wind and automatic movements are common in skeleton styles. Automatic models wind with motion, while hand-wind models require regular winding. Choose based on how often you wear the watch and your tolerance for winding.

What design elements matter for readability?

Roman numerals are classic but can be harder to read at a glance. Skeleton dials reveal gears that enhance aesthetics but may reduce legibility in low light. Consider dial contrast and the size of numerals when readability is a priority.

How important is the case and finish?

Gold-tone cases with engraved details deliver vintage appeal. Some models use acrylic front crystals; others use metal or glass. For durability, prioritize metal cases and scratch-resistant surfaces and note any limitations of acrylic.

What about the chain and wearability?

Pocket watch chains vary in width and length. Ensure the chain length fits your wardrobe and intended use. A longer chain provides more flexibility for formal wear; a shorter chain can feel neater for daily use.

Maintenance tips and cautions

Avoid magnets to prevent timing disturbances. Wind watches regularly if not worn daily to keep lubricants distributed. Protect from moisture and shocks, and store in a protective box or pouch when not in use.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is a skeleton pocket watch? A watch with a transparent or cut-away dial that reveals the inner gears and mechanisms.
  • Are gold skeleton watches suitable for every occasion? They are ideal for formal and vintage-themed events; more casual settings may benefit from a subtler design.
  • Do these watches require battery replacement? Most are mechanical and wind manually or automatically; no battery is required.
  • How do I prevent magnet interference? Keep the watch away from strong magnets and electronic devices that emit magnetic fields.
  • What maintenance is needed? Regular winding (for hand-wind models), gentle cleaning, and proper storage protect the movement and finish.
  • Can skeleton watches be worn daily? Yes, but consider the case material, finish, and chain comfort for daily wear.
